Pathlab is updating its coeliac disease testing algorithm to improve efficiency while maintaining clinical accuracy.
From 11 November 2025, total IgA will no longer be tested upfront for all coeliac requests; instead, it will be added only when the initial anti-tTG IgA result suggests possible IgA deficiency. Anti-DGP IgG will continue to be added automatically when IgA is <0.05 g/L.
